An underactive thyroid test (also known as TSH test) is a simple, non-invasive way to assess thyroid function, specifically to check for hypothyroidism, which is when the thyroid gland does not produce enough thyroid hormone. The TSH Test measures the amount of th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H) in your blood, which could be an indicator of thyroid disease. Thyroid stimulating hormone (TSH) signals the thyroid gland to make hormones that control how your body uses and stores energy, called metabolism. When TSH and thyroid hormones are out of balance, this can cause a range of issues relating to the muscles, breathing, body temperature, and more. Testing the TSH level in your blood can reveal if your thyroid gland is functioning normally.
Normal th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H) levels typically fall between 0.4 and 4.0 milliunits per liter (mU/L). This TSH test detects elevated levels above 5 μIU/ml, which may indicate hypothyroidism and require further investigation.
Various factors can lead to hypothyroidism, including insufficient thyroid hormone production, lack of iodine, genetic predispositions, chronic inflammation, and hormonal shifts during pregnancy and menopause.
An underactive thyroid can often be successfully treated by taking daily hormone tablets to replace the hormones your thyroid is not making. People who have a thyroid disorder are likely to require regular TSH testing to ensure that their symptoms remain under control.
Common Symptoms of Underactive Thyroid or Hypothyroidism:
- Persistent fatigue and lack of energy
- Slow heart rate
- Cold intolerance
- Depression
- Painful joints and muscles
- Dry skin and brittle nails
- Hair loss
- Irregular menstrual periods
- Memory challenges

How To Perform the Test?
The procedure is quick and simple. Start by washing your hands or cleaning with an alcohol swab, then massage your hand towards the fingertip. Use a sterile lancet to puncture the skin, wipe away the first drop of blood, and gently rub your hand to form a rounded drop. Use the capillary dropper to collect the blood and transfer it to the test cassette without squeezing the bulb.
Testing should be performed immediately after the fingerstick whole blood specimen has been collected.
How To Read The Test Results?
This test can be used to screen for thyroid hormone levels using a simple blood sample. A TSH value above the normal range may indicate the thyroid is underactive. In rare cases, a high TSH result might be impacted by a pituitary gland issue, such as a tumor, which causes excessive production of TSH. A high TSH value can also occur in people with an underactive thyroid glands who have been receiving too little thyroid hormone medication.
As well, pregnancy and Hashimoto’s thyroiditis might also cause an abnormally high TSH reading.
